As online platforms grapple with how to establish trust at a global scale and address growing concerns about authenticity, the adoption of profile verification on LinkedIn is picking up pace in 2025 India is emerging as the fastest-growing market for profile verification, highlighting the country’s expanding influence on how digital work networks operate LinkedIn members are adding around 30 million verifications to their profiles each year, with adoption up more than 38% year-over-year in 2025, Oscar Rodriguez, LinkedIn’s vice-president of trust products

The increase follows the company’s announcement last week that more than 100 million users have added at least one verification In 2022, LinkedIn began rolling out profile verification to provide clearer signals of authenticity on the platform It initially focused on confirming members’ workplace or identity, including through company email addresses, before expanding to government-issued ID checks, and have since been extended to company pages and job listings

Most LinkedIn members who have added a verification to their profile have done so by confirming their association with a workplace, typically using a company email address or similar credentials, rather than verifying their personal identity

About 60% of verified members have confirmed a workplace affiliation, typically using a company email address, while roughly 27% have verified their identity using a government-issued ID, Rodriguez said
